author/架構學而思

全面身份化:零信任安全的基石

在 2018 ISC 網際網路安全大會的身份安全分論壇上,《零信任網路》作者 Evan Gilman 以“工作負載的身份:零信任資料中心網路的基石”為題發表了演講。 Evan 從零信任的理論基礎出發,提出資料

架構設計之服務限流

限流可以認為服務降級的一種,限流就是限制系統的輸入和輸出流量已達到保護系統的目的。一般來說系統的吞吐量是可以被測算的,為了保證系統的穩定執行,一旦達到的需要限制的閾值,就需要限制流量並採取一些措施以完成限制流量

轉型架構師必讀:實用架構的搭建思路

因為碎片化的時間多了,休閒的時候,我關注了一些架構相關的內容。發現有很多同道中人正在經歷著我前兩年經歷的階段,對於做架構沒有相對具象的一些理解,更沒有系統化的認識。所以,我把看到的問題、回答過的問題中的部分內

軟體架構:5種你應該知道的模式

Singleton(單例模式)、倉儲模式(repository)、工廠模式(factory)、建造者模式(builder)、裝飾模式(decorator)……大概每個上課聽講的程式員都不會陌生——軟體的設計模式

重用和單一職責可能是對立的

單一職責是讓一段程式碼只做一件事,實現一個功能,軟體複雜性來自於讓一段程式碼做兩件事: "So much complexity in software comes from trying to ma

DDD 極簡入門教程

概述 DDD(Domain-Driven Design 領域驅動設計)是由Eric Evans最先提出,目的是軟體所涉及到的領域進行建模,以應對系統規模過大引起的軟體複雜性的問題。整過的過程大概是這樣的,

資深架構師,講述大型網站的系統架構演變過程

先舉個例子感受一下千萬級到底是什麼數量級? 之前很流行的優步(Uber),從媒體公佈的資訊看,它每天接單量平均在百萬左右, 假如每天有10個小時的服務時間,平均QPS只有30左右。對於一個後臺伺服器,單機的

如何設計一個微型分散式架構?

序言(初衷) 設計該系統初衷是基於描繪業務(或機器叢集)儲存模型,分析代理快取伺服器磁碟儲存與回源率的關係。系統意義是在騰訊雲成本優化過程中,量化指導機房裝置擴容。前半部分是介紹背景,對CDN快取模型做一些

1746055805.8672